GEHL Z80 Excavator Detailed Specifications
#1
The GEHL Z80 Excavator is a high-performance medium-sized hydraulic excavator designed for earthworks, infrastructure construction, and mining operations. Its reliable power system and excellent hydraulic technology ensure efficient operation even in harsh environments, offering outstanding working capabilities and durability. The GEHL Z80 provides strong power output, excellent fuel economy, and a comfortable operating environment, making it an ideal choice for a wide range of applications in the construction industry.

Official Specifications List
1. Machine Dimensions and Weight
  • Model: Z80
  • Operating Weight: 8,500 kg
  • Overall Length: 6,400 mm
  • Overall Width: 2,350 mm
  • Overall Height (Cab Top): 2,650 mm
  • Wheelbase: 2,520 mm
  • Minimum Ground Clearance: 400 mm
2. Working Range
  • Maximum Digging Height: 7,350 mm
  • Maximum Dumping Height: 5,050 mm
  • Maximum Digging Depth: 4,350 mm
  • Maximum Digging Radius: 7,680 mm
  • Maximum Vertical Digging Depth: 4,000 mm
3. Powertrain
  • Engine Model: GEHL G6C-1
  • Rated Power: 75 kW (101 hp)
  • Rated Speed: 2,200 rpm
  • Emission Standard: Tier 3
  • Fuel Tank Capacity: 250 L
4. Hydraulic System
  • Main Pump Type: Load-Sensing Variable Pump
  • Main Pump Flow: 2 × 280 L/min
  • System Operating Pressure: 32 MPa
5. Travel Performance
  • Maximum Travel Speed: 6.0 km/h
  • Gradeability: 30°
  • Steering Angle: ±40°
  • Minimum Turning Radius: 4,200 mm
  • Brake Type: Hydraulic Brake
6. Other Features
  • Standard Bucket Capacity: 0.35 m³
  • Working Device Type: Backhoe
  • Cabin: Fully enclosed air-conditioned cabin with shock-absorbing seat and noise-isolating design
